网站地图官方微信:
网站首页 璜泾镇 张坊乡 怀宝镇 龙川镇 蒙自乡 勐秀乡

当前位置: 首页 >

count(*) count(1)哪个更快?

团队 code review 时,一位同事把 count(*)改成了 count(1),说这样性能更好。

真的是这样吗?今天通过源码和实测数据,把这个问题说透。

本文基于 MySQL 8.0.28 版本测试,不同版本的优化器行为可能有差异 三种 count 方式的本质区别先看看这三种写法在 MySQL 中到底做了什么: // 模拟MySQL处理count的伪代码 public class CountProcessor { // count(*) 的处理逻辑 public long countStar(Table table) { long count = 0; for …。

count(*)  count(1)哪个更快?

  • | 我上大一,需要买电脑,一共9000,但我妈说她给我3000,我心里很不舒服,怎么办? |

    在我小的时候,我爸曾掐着我妈脖子,让她拿出钱来买一台六千块钱...

    查看详情>>
  • | 《诛仙》作者萧鼎于近日修改《诛仙》原作并大量删去碧瑶戏份,如何看待这一行为? |

  • | Mac上有那些你认为极其好用的***? |

  • | Linux 有哪些『赛博灯泡』? |

  • | nodejs适合作为后端主要技术栈吗? |

  • | 什么事情是你当了老板才知道的? |

  • | 到底有什么是 Node.js 无法实现的? |

  • | MacOS的哪个设计让你非常恼火? |

  • | 程序员五六年了,感觉除了程序什么也不懂,很焦虑怎么办? |

  • | 编译器和解释器的分界线在哪,字节码效率能否无限接近机器码? |

  • | 为什么戴上***眼镜看自己好丑,五官更为扁平? |

  • 我们产品一个go实现的后台,高并发大流量时cpu十分繁忙,g...

    2025-06-28
  • 2024年7月在武汉因为工作原因接到了一个预约 对方说的是海...

    2025-06-28
  • 之前跟我对象聊到《死亡搁浅2:冥滩之上》,我说很犹豫买数字版...

    2025-06-28
  • 就不想用rust吗?局面打开,j***a写一堆class太臃...

    2025-06-28

关注我们

添加微信好友,关注最新动态